Maple-Balsamic Roasted Sweet Potatoes with Rosemary
Crispy, sweet, and savory roasted sweet potatoes with a sticky maple-balsamic glaze — a showstopping side dish that’s ready in 25 minutes. Ingredients
- 3 medium sweet potatoes
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 tbsp pure maple syrup
- 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ar
- 1 tsp fresh rosemary
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/8 tsp black pepper
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at oven to 425°F. Peel and cut 3 medium sweet potatoes into 3/4-inch cubes. Toss with 2 tbsp olive oil, 1 tbsp pure maple syrup, 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ar, 1/4 tsp salt, and 1/8 tsp black pepper until evenly coated.
- Step 2: Spread sweet potatoes in a single layer on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Roast for 20 minutes, flipping halfway through, until edges are crisp and golden brown.
- Step 3: Remove from oven and sprinkle with 1 tsp finely chopped fresh rosemary. Return to oven for 2 more minutes to toast the rosemary slightly. Transfer to a serving dish and let cool for 5 minutes before serving.

How do I store leftover Maple-Balsamic Roasted Sweet Potatoes with Rosemary?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ep medium sweet potatoes from drying out.

How do I scale Maple-Balsamic Roasted Sweet Potatoes with Rosemary for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
